CHINESE GORAL
Naemorhedus goral arnouxianus
©Laura Quick

The Chinese goral lives in the steep slopes of wooded mountains in east-central China. Most commonly, they live at 3,000 to 8,000 feet but they have been seen at much higher altitudes. Chinese gorals are shy, but territorial creatures that live in groups of up to twelve individuals. They have a stout body and weigh from 48 to 77 pounds. Their wooly undercoat with long, coarse guard hairs is well suited for life in a cold climate. Their summer coat is shorter and thinner.
